Prof. Bolton Chau Honoured with RGC Research Fellow Scheme Fellowship

The Department of Rehabilitation Sciences is delighted to announce that Prof. Bolton Chau has been awarded a fellowship under the Research Grants Council’s (RGC) Research Fellow Scheme (RFS) for 2026/27. The scheme offers support for Prof. Chau’s continued innovations and breakthroughs in cognitive neuroscience.

 

The RGC received 35 nominations for the RFS. Among PolyU’s six nominations, Prof. Chau was shortlisted for interview and ultimately received this prestigious fellowship. This marks a significant milestone, as he is the first academic staff member in the Department to receive this award.

 

Prof. Chau’s project is titled “How distractors bias choices: Investigating mechanisms through computational modelling, neuroimaging, neurochemistry and neurostimulation.” The project seeks to investigate how human decisions are influenced by distracting information through the use of advanced cognitive neuroscience techniques. By combining computational modelling, functional magnetic resonance imaging (fMRI), magnetic resonance spectroscopy (MRS) and transcranial magnetic stimulation (TMS), the research will examine the neurocomputational mechanisms underlying decision-making biases. The findings are expected to have important practical implications for strengthening evidence-based policy-making, promoting unbiased decision-making, and supporting the development of treatments for psychiatric disorders.
